  $250k Bail for Teacher Accused in Sex Assault

Chicago Sun-Times
February 6, 2010

http://www.suntimes.com/news/24-7/2032981,CST-NWS-cath06.article

A former Catholic high school teacher was ordered held in lieu of $250,000 bail Friday for the alleged sexual assault of a female student.

Police said Wesley Cherniak, 32, attacked the then-16-year-old girl last year at St. Benedict High School, 3900 N. Leavitt, where he had been teaching.

The student's parents reported the alleged attack to the assistant principal on May 13, 2009, according to Archdiocese of Chicago spokeswoman Susan Burritt.

Cherniak was subsequently suspended from the school, Burritt said.

He was arrested at his home Wednesday in the 3800 block of North Bernard.
